Laboratory Diagnostics in Nigeria: Advancing Healthcare through Testing
Laboratory diagnostics play a critical role in the Nigerian healthcare landscape. They enable accurate detection of diseases, guide treatment approaches, and monitor patient progress. With advancements in technology and infrastructure, laboratory testing capacity is increasing across the country, empowering healthcare professionals to provide comprehensive care.
From routine blood tests to sophisticated molecular diagnostics, laboratories are provided with a wide range of tools to examine biological samples. This enables timely intervention of various ailments, including infectious diseases, chronic illnesses, and genetic disorders.
The role of laboratory testing in Nigeria extends beyond individual patient care. It also contributes to public health surveillance, disease outbreak response, and the development of targeted healthcare policies. As technology continues to evolve, laboratory diagnostics in Nigeria are poised to make even greater strides in advancing healthcare and improving patient outcomes.
DNA Analysis in Nigeria: A Tool for Personalized Medicine
Nigeria is embarking a new era of healthcare with the emergence of DNA analysis as a powerful tool for implementing personalized medicine. This innovative approach utilizes genetic information to tailor medical interventions based on an individual's unique blueprint. By analyzing a person's DNA, healthcare professionals can determine their susceptibility to certain conditions, enabling proactive detection and mitigation. This advancement holds immense opportunity for improving health outcomes in Nigeria.
The benefits of DNA analysis in personalized medicine are diverse. It allows for targeted therapy plans, minimizing side effects and maximizing efficacy. Furthermore, it can assist doctors in selecting the most suitable medications based on an individual's genetic makeup.
However, there are obstacles to widespread adoption of DNA analysis in Nigeria. These include constraints in access to testing facilities, the high cost of genetic testing, and the need for enhanced public understanding about its benefits and potential. Overcoming these challenges will be pivotal in harnessing the full opportunity of DNA analysis for personalized medicine in Nigeria.
